Grassroots Innovation

Grassroots innovation is a diverse set of activities in which networks of neighbours, community groups, and activists work with people to generate bottom-up solutions for sustainable developments; novel solutions that respond to the local situation and the interests and values of the communities involved; and where those communities have control over the process and outcomes. Examples include community renewable energy initiatives, eco-housing, local organic food schemes, and community currencies such as time banks.
